Long Beach Swapmeet this Sunday March 25th

24Cycle/BeerBreed will be vending at the Long Beach Cycle Swapmeet. If any of you are vending there let me know so I can pass by and do a little treasure hunting. I like to buy from fellow 33 guys when I can to support our habits.
I will be in spots 214,215,216 and were bringing a good pile of stuff.
Ironhead goods from 60s and 70s
Pan, Shovel and Flat Side harley parts
Chopper goodness , frames, front ends, tins ect
I will also be bringing some old Ironhead Relics looking for new care takers. I hope to be bringing a Shovelhead or 2. All bikes have titles and matching numbers.

NO it's not a dumb question. They give you a 1$ dicount if you ride in... I know, totally lame. Expect to pay $10.00 to get in. Count how many non-cycle vendors you see and ask yourself if it's fucking worth it.... go on I dare you.
But, Atoms going to have some good stuff there, 90% of the rest is CRAP, chrome, and made in China. Those of you who know what I'm talking about know what I'm talking about.
